    About Thomson-East Coast Line 2:
    With the six new TEL2 stations - Springleaf, Lentor, Mayflower, Bright Hill, Upper Thomson and Caldecott - you can now get #CloserToEverything that matters. 🤎 Residents in the Thomson area who were previously not served directly by a rail line can look forward to greater connectivity to and around the city. The new TEL Caldecott station and Bright Hill station serves as an interchange to the Circle Line (#CCL) and the future Cross-Island Line (#CRL) respectively.
    The 43km TEL is Singapore’s sixth #MRT line, adding 32 new stations to the existing rail network, eight of which are interchange stations. When fully operational, TEL is expected to serve approximately 500,000 commuters daily in the initial years, and this will increase to about one million commuters in the longer term.
